## Why Build Your Own PC?

Before diving into the steps, let’s talk about why building your own PC is worth the effort.

Cost-Effective: While pre-built PCs are convenient, they often come with a premium price tag. Building your own allows you to allocate your budget where it matters most.

Customization: You get to choose every component, ensuring your PC meets your exact needs, whether it’s for gaming, video editing, or general use.

Upgradeability: When you build your own PC, you can easily swap out parts in the future, keeping your system up-to-date without needing a full replacement.

Learning Experience: There’s no better way to understand how a computer works than by assembling one yourself.

## What You’ll Need to Get Started

Before you begin, gather the following tools and components:

### Essential Tools
– A Phillips-head screwdriver (magnetic tips are helpful)
– An anti-static wrist strap (to prevent static damage)
– Zip ties (for cable management)
– Thermal paste (if not pre-applied to your CPU cooler)

### PC Components
CPU (Central Processing Unit): The brain of your computer.
Motherboard: The main circuit board that connects all components.
RAM (Random Access Memory): Temporary memory for running applications.
Storage (SSD/HDD): Where your files and operating system are stored.
GPU (Graphics Processing Unit): Handles graphics rendering, crucial for gaming.
Power Supply Unit (PSU): Powers all components.
Case: Houses all your parts and provides cooling.
Cooling System: Air or liquid cooling to keep temperatures in check.
Operating System: Windows, Linux, or macOS (if compatible).

## Step 1 Choosing the Right Components

Selecting the right parts is crucial for a smooth build. Here’s a breakdown of what to consider for each component:

### CPU
The CPU is the heart of your PC. In 2025, you’ll want to look at the latest offerings from Intel and AMD. For gaming, a high clock speed is ideal, while content creators may prefer more cores for multitasking.

### Motherboard
Your motherboard must be compatible with your CPU. Check the socket type (e.g., LGA 1700 for Intel or AM5 for AMD) and ensure it has the features you need, like enough RAM slots and PCIe lanes.

### RAM
For most users, 16GB of RAM is sufficient, but if you’re into heavy multitasking or video editing, 32GB is a better choice. DDR5 is the standard in 2025, offering faster speeds and better efficiency.

### Storage
SSDs are a must for speed. A 1TB NVMe SSD is a great starting point, but you can add more storage later. HDDs are cheaper but slower, so they’re best for bulk storage.

### GPU
The GPU is critical for gaming and graphics work. NVIDIA and AMD are the top choices, with NVIDIA leading in ray tracing and AMD offering better value in some cases.

### Power Supply Unit (PSU)
A good PSU is essential for stability. Aim for at least 650W for a mid-range build, and ensure it’s 80 Plus certified for efficiency.

### Case
Your case should have good airflow and enough space for your components. Consider factors like cable management and aesthetics.

### Cooling
Air coolers are sufficient for most builds, but liquid cooling can offer better performance and looks for high-end setups.

## Step 2 Preparing Your Workspace

Before you start assembling, set up a clean, well-lit workspace. Use an anti-static mat or work on a wooden table to avoid static electricity. Keep your components organized and within reach.

## Step 3 Installing the CPU

1. Open the CPU socket on the motherboard by lifting the retention arm.
2. Align the CPU with the socket (look for the triangle marker).
3. Gently place the CPU into the socket—no force is needed.
4. Lower the retention arm to secure the CPU.

## Step 4 Installing the RAM

1. Open the clips on the RAM slots.
2. Align the notch on the RAM stick with the slot.
3. Press down firmly on both ends until the clips snap into place.

## Step 5 Installing the Motherboard into the Case

1. Place the I/O shield into the case’s rear opening.
2. Align the motherboard with the standoffs in the case.
3. Screw the motherboard into place, ensuring it’s secure but not overtightened.

## Step 6 Installing the Power Supply Unit (PSU)

1. Place the PSU into its designated area in the case.
2. Secure it with screws.
3. Route the cables neatly to avoid clutter.

## Step 7 Installing Storage

1. For M.2 SSDs, insert the drive into the slot and secure it with a screw.
2. For SATA SSDs or HDDs, mount them in the drive bays and connect the SATA and power cables.

## Step 8 Installing the GPU

1. Remove the case’s PCIe slot covers.
2. Align the GPU with the PCIe slot on the motherboard.
3. Press down until it clicks into place.
4. Secure the GPU to the case with screws.

## Step 9 Connecting Cables

1. Connect the 24-pin ATX power cable to the motherboard.
2. Connect the 8-pin CPU power cable.
3. Connect SATA power cables to your storage drives.
4. Connect the front panel connectors (power button, USB ports, etc.).

## Step 10 Powering On Your PC

1. Double-check all connections.
2. Plug in the power cable and turn on the PSU.
3. Press the power button on the case.
4. If everything is connected correctly, your PC should boot up!

## Troubleshooting Common Issues

If your PC doesn’t turn on, here are a few things to check:

Power Connections: Ensure all cables are properly connected.
RAM Seating: Reseat the RAM sticks.
CPU Installation: Make sure the CPU is correctly placed.
Front Panel Connectors: Verify the power button is connected properly.
